Embraer Partners with SpaceX to Bring Starlink Satellite Internet to Business Jets

Embraer, a leading manufacturer of business jets, has announced a partnership with SpaceX to bring Starlink satellite internet to its fleet of aircraft. This move aims to provide passengers with a seamless connectivity experience, strengthening Embraer's commitment to connected flight experiences worldwide.

Starlink, SpaceX's constellation of low Earth orbit satellites, offers high-speed internet services even in remote areas or over oceans. With over a year of operational experience and hundreds of kits sold to the business aviation fleet, Starlink is considered the preeminent solution for in-flight connectivity.

United Airlines received approval to install Starlink Wi-Fi on its Embraer 175 regional aircraft earlier this year. Similarly, the Praetor, one of the most technologically advanced business jets in its category, now offers Starlink Wi-Fi as an option. Operators of Praetor and Legacy jets can now equip their aircraft with Starlink Wi-Fi directly through the manufacturer, ensuring seamless integration and support.

The Praetor 500 and Legacy 450 have already received FAA approval for Starlink installation, with the Praetor 600 and Legacy 500 expected to follow suit in the third quarter of 2025. Brazil's ANAC is targeting Starlink certification for the Praetor 600 and Legacy 500 in Q4, while EASA approval is expected in early 2026.

The high-speed, low-latency Wi-Fi solution is provided through a Supplemental Type Certificate (STC) developed in partnership with Nextant Aerospace and Flexjet. Marsha Woelber, VP of Customer Support and Aftermarket Sales for Executive Jets at Embraer, expressed excitement about bringing Starlink's high-speed internet to customers.

JSX, a shared jet service, outfitted its entire fleet of 40 Embraer regional jets with Starlink in 2023. However, Starlink encountered issues on United Express E175 jets, leading to a temporary suspension of deployment. Despite this setback, the partnership between Embraer and SpaceX continues to move forward, bringing the promise of reliable, high-speed internet to business jet passengers.
